Calculate Log Base 304 of 259

To solve the equation log 304 (259) = x carry out the following steps.
  1. Apply the change of base rule:
    log a (x) = log b (x) / log b (a)
    With b = 10:
    log a (x) = log(x) / log(a)
  2. Substitute the variables:
    With x = 259, a = 304:
    log 304 (259) = log(259) / log(304)
  3. Evaluate the term:
    log(259) / log(304)
    = 1.39794000867204 / 1.92427928606188
    = 0.97197850910058
    = Logarithm of 259 with base 304
